Lysacek and the Lakers: Just a bunch of champions


Evan Lysacek will bve presenting the first ball at the LA Lakers game on Monday. It's fantastic that becoming world champion opens these doors for him.

Evan Lysacek and the Lakers practice in the same facility, the Toyota Center in El Segundo. They've won major titles as the result of their performances at Staples Center, where the Lakers won three NBA championships and Lysacek last month claimed the world figure skating championship.

So it makes sense for Lysacek, an Illinois native who has enthusiastically adopted Los Angeles as his home, to share the floor with the Lakers -- if only briefly -- before they resume their first-round playoff series against the Utah Jazz.

Lysacek will be introduced at the game Monday and will present the game ball for the opening tipoff, a well-deserved honor. It will also be a rare occasion when he's surrounded by athletes who are taller than he is: He's about 6 foot 1, extremely tall for a figure skater.
